I appreciate anyone who take the time to read this post. So, is there a utility to insert whitespace to maximize similarity between text files? Some of the file contents look like this: Function 0x7fffe55aea80 is filtered, no tracing I want to point out that the file does not consist only of numbers, but a variety of text. Can diff or another tool insert whitespace to equalize the file size and allow me to continue the byte-by-byte comparison? I can't go line-by line, because sometimes a whole line may be missing, and so I need whitespace to fill that gap too. diff and beyondcompare figure out that this is happening. I have a program that performs a byte-by-byte comparison, and so after the For example, here is a part of log file 1: 18: 1Īs you can see, the values are off by one, causing the file size to be off by one as well. They are largely the same, but differ in some places messing up the alignment. Winmerge is an Open Source file comparison tool.I have two trace text files from a PIN Tracer to compare byte by byte for an algorithm I am working on. You can create different sessions with different filters. <- I wrote that in 2008! This was implemented by using sessions. PS: Begin this year I was promised by Scootersoftware Support that they would implement a way to enable/disable filters on a per filter bases in the next revision of the tool. ![]() Ignore removed comments after End_Object,End_Class,End_Function,End_Procedure Use statement vs missing Use statementġ1. Ignore the public keyword in property declarations Rules-based comparison uses the same content comparison method as double clicking to view file contents. The default settings in the Folder Compare use file size and modified date for comparison. ![]() Make sure View > Ignore Unimportant Differences is turned on. In the example, all lines are detected as different. Check Compare Contents and select Rules-based comparison. Ignore meta tag documentation changes between 12.Ĩ. If you are not sure which option your document requires, this is probably the safest choice. Replace string with date / integer / number to filter other similar code.ħ. Ignore changed writing style for constants: C$_FOO vs C_$FOO I using version 3.2.3 and doing a tex file comparision of two xml files, but Im unable to get it to ignore the whitespace differences. Ignore difference between writing "Use foo" and "Use foo.pkg"ĥ. Ignore "current_object" vs "self" syntaxĤ. This is also the place where you can add custom rules/filtersģ. Importance Tab Page Unimportant text group > put a check in all of the checkboxes In order to change the rules on how BC compares, you should go into compare source mode -> compare two source files -> and then click on the "guy with the cap" in the toolbarĪssociated with: *.src *.pkg *.dg *.vw *.dd *.sl *.ddo *.rv *.tt? *.wo *.utl *.nui Enable the line filters you want to use and run your comparison. In the Filters dialog, click the Linefilters tab, create the following line filter (add) //ignore. ![]() Main menu -> Tools -> File Formats -> Press the "+" button to add a new file format -> Text Format When you launch a file compare from the Select Files or Folders dialog, after choosing the Left and Right files, click Select next to the Filter field. ![]() In order to have Beyond Compare recognize DataFlex based on File Type, you can add the following after starting the main program. How-to set up Beyond Compare Configure File Formats Other alternatives for Windows include Araxis merge, WinDiff and Winmerge.įor a comparison of file comparison tools visit Wikipedia.īeyond Compare is a commonly used File Comparison tool developed by Scooter Software. There are many different file comparison tools out there, the most commonly used being Beyond Compare. The tool has the ability to ignore letter case and whitespace changes. If you are not using a product for this then GO BUY ONE! it is the best investment you can make EVER. I have two files, one with PC line endings, the other with 'Mix'. If you want to compare whitespace differences in text files, this is your tool. The tips below are for a product called Beyond Compare, but i'm sure your product will do fine too. When comparing source between different Visual DataFlex versions it is a HUGE time saver to do this using source code compare tools.īelow is a few rules one can use to compare sources between VDF11.1 and VDF12.1
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|